Meaning and Origin
Tymarion is a masculine name of African American origin. Its roots can be traced to the combination of the prefix "Ty," often used in names like Tyrone, and the last name "Marion." "Ty," a common prefix for many names, often carries a sense of strength and honor. "Marion," on the other hand, boasts a rich history as a popular French given name associated with resilience and fortitude. The name Tymarion, therefore, blends these meanings, embodying a spirit of strength and perseverance.
Pronunciation and Spelling
Tymarion is relatively straightforward to pronounce. The emphasis falls on the second syllable, "ma," with the name sounding like "tie-MAR-ee-on." While the name is not commonly encountered, its phonetic elements make it easy for people to grasp and pronounce correctly. The only potential challenge might arise from the "y" at the beginning, which some might mispronounce as a "j" sound. However, this is easily corrected with a gentle reminder.

Nickname Choices
Tymarion lends itself to several charming nicknames. "Ty" is a natural and popular choice, reflecting the name's origins and offering a simple and approachable alternative. "Marion" is another option, drawing upon the name's historical significance and providing a more formal and dignified nickname. Additionally, "Tymar" or "Mar" could be used for a more playful and unique approach. The choice of nickname ultimately depends on personal preference and the individual's personality.

Variation and Similar Names
While variations of the name are scarce, it shares similarities with names like Tamarion, Tyrion, Omarion, Amarion, and Tamarin. These names, like Tymarion, possess a distinctive sound and a touch of individuality.
